Output 6540aa94f2a3877668949d82d1c36b87d37217810c1b628f65bc4e83ca0fc263:0

value
319814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ac7c563b489e4c9e019b0c78c74d8dae13b073 OP_EQUAL
address
3MSgWVfWcuijBKHU7B6yFwVAdeMDJ181Jc
transaction
6540aa94f2a3877668949d82d1c36b87d37217810c1b628f65bc4e83ca0fc263
spent
true